Deep in the valleys of Southern Chile, master weavers carry forward the sacred textile traditions of the Mapuche people. Their hands hold knowledge passed down through generations, weaving symbols and stories that speak of family heritage and cultural identity.
Each piece emerges from looms where ancient techniques meet collaborative design, creating textiles that honor the past while embracing the present. These artisans infuse every thread with meaning, transforming simple cotton into vessels of cultural preservation.
Through fair trade partnership and educational opportunities, these skilled craftspeople sustain their communities while sharing their extraordinary gifts with the world. Q: What is flammé weaving technique?
A: Flammé is a traditional weaving method that creates distinctive soft, fluffy texture through specialized handweaving techniques passed down through indigenous communities. The process involves varying yarn tensions and weaving patterns to achieve the characteristic surface texture.
